Political Bodies
At a time when the far right is ascending to power around the world, the 2020 Brazilian municipal elections saw a surprising and unprecedented record of LGBT candidates. This film follows four young queer politicians during their electoral campaigns and reveals their struggle to affirm their rights to exist and be heard.

Director, screenwriter, actor and journalist, he is the founder of the production company Representa, focused on promoting diversity of bodies and narratives. He directed and created award-winning music videos for Tulipa Ruiz, Liniker, Letrux, Majur and Illy. He wrote the script for the second season of the documentary series Quebrando o Tabu, for GNT, in addition to TV shows by Regina Casé, Angélica and Fabio Porchat. Selected with the documentary Ecos on It's All True Festival (É Tudo Verdade), in 2009, he finished his second film as director and screenwriter, Political Bodies (Corpolítica), scheduled for release soon.
Our film seeks to awaken more political bodies and the awareness that it is through politics and the representation of LGBTQIA+ politicians that we will stop being the country that kills the most LGBTQIA+ in the world. We live in a country where, in addition, we have a President of the Republic who says that "gay son is a lack of beating". We can no longer admit, naturalize or relativize this fact, the murder of a parliamentarian like Marielle Franco or the exile of Jean Wyllys. Andréa, Erika, Monica and William, people who woke up and faced elections for the first time in 2020, bring us hope to change this tragic scenario.
